Ethanol bust adds to U.S. fuel glut and losses across Corn Belt
Story Date: 3/24/2016

SOURCE: BLOOMBERG, 3/23/16


The 400-or-so residents of Waltonville, Illinois, have been waiting almost a decade to cash in on the U.S. ethanol boom. Now, that day may never come as a prolonged fuel glut alters the economics of corn for communities across the Midwest.
